There are three types of deployment services offered for both the products Atom and Assist.

<aside> <img src="/icons/info-alternate_lightgray.svg" alt="/icons/info-alternate_lightgray.svg" width="40px" /> Please note that for on-premise deployments, clients need to provide us with CA signed SSL Certificate. Self-signed certificates will not be accepted!

</aside>

On-Cloud


In this type of deployment, the web, the communication and the blob storage used are on Imaginate servers

Custom


In this type of deployment, the web and communication server are Imaginate servers and the blob storage is client’s own Azure blob storage. For setting the blob storage, the client needs to provide the following information - Protocol, Account Name, Account Key, Blob URL, SAS Token.

Refer Getting Account Info to know more about the required info and how to retrieve it.

On-Premise


In this type of deployment , all the servers (web and communication) are set up on the client’s physical premise. For the blob storage, the client may pick local storage or his own Azure as the data storage/repository option.

On-premise deployments can be either with internet or without internet.

With Internet


This means all servers deployed at client location can access the Atom/Assist app using an open-internet. Hence, the web dashboard URL provided by the client is accessible outside of their premise as well. Likewise, client can also access various sites on the internet (barring the firewall restrictions).

With Intranet


This means all servers deployed at client location can access the Atom/Assist app using only an intranet. Hence, the web dashboard URL provided by the client is not accessible outside of their premise. Likewise, client also cannot access any of the internet sites.

Since access to internet is restricted, certain features on Atom WILL NOT work.

Basic Requirements of servers for on-premise deployment


<aside> <img src="/icons/exclamation-mark_red.svg" alt="/icons/exclamation-mark_red.svg" width="40px" /> Please note that for on-prem deployment, clients need to provide us with CA signed SSL Certificate. Self-signed certificates will not be accepted!

</aside>

<aside> <img src="/icons/info-alternate_lightgray.svg" alt="/icons/info-alternate_lightgray.svg" width="40px" /> The performance will vary based on number of users/licenses.

</aside>

<aside> <img src="/icons/info-alternate_lightgray.svg" alt="/icons/info-alternate_lightgray.svg" width="40px" /> If there are additional devices on which you want the installation done, you may refer to this section.

</aside>